About the Moment of Inertia Converter

Moment of inertia (also called rotational inertia) measures how difficult it is to change the rotational speed of an object — the rotational equivalent of mass in linear motion. It depends on both the mass and how that mass is distributed relative to the rotation axis. The SI unit is kg·m². Engineers use it in flywheel design, motor selection, gear systems, and any application involving rotating machinery.

Quick facts
  • A solid cylinder's moment of inertia = ½mr² — hollow cylinders are harder to spin for the same mass
  • Figure skaters pull in their arms to reduce moment of inertia and spin faster (conservation of angular momentum)
  • Flywheels in energy storage systems are designed with high moment of inertia to store more rotational energy
  • Moment of inertia × angular acceleration = torque (the rotational analogue of F = ma)
Common uses: Mechanical engineering, robotics, electric motors, flywheel systems, vehicle dynamics
